After seeing sturdy promoting stress earlier this week, April lean hog futures bulls got here roaring again to life the latter half of this week. As soon as once more, the hog market bulls have proven eager resilience after a strong value unload. Technicals in hog futures have improved and hog merchants are rising extra assured of an prolonged money hog market rally. The newest CME lean hog index is up 52 cents to $84.60 as of Feb. 4, rising the rise from the seasonal low to $4.17. Bulls have additionally lately been inspired by decreased hog slaughter ranges that recommend USDA’s projected hog inhabitants will not be as huge because the company reported.

Weekly USDA US pork export gross sales

Pork: Web gross sales of fifty,700 MT for 2025 have been primarily for Mexico (21,000 MT, together with decreases of 600 MT), South Korea (7,200 MT, together with decreases of 1,700 MT), Japan (6,500 MT, together with decreases of 500 MT), the Bahamas (4,700 MT), and Colombia (3,600 MT, together with decreases of 200 MT). Exports of 37,800 MT have been primarily to Mexico (13,900 MT), Japan (5,500 MT), South Korea (4,000 MT), China (3,600 MT), and Canada (2,700 MT).

Export Changes: Amassed exports of pork have been adjusted down 6,487 MT to the Bahamas (4,690 MT), the Netherland Antilles (436 MT), the Dominican Republic (401 MT), Chile (289 MT), South Korea (236 MT), the U.S. Virgin Islands (118 MT), Haiti (92 MT), El Salvador (50 MT), Honduras (44 MT), Panama (37 MT), the Turks and Caicos Islands (29 MT), Guatemala (22 MT), Mexico (21 MT), Barbados (9 MT), Ecuador (8 MT), Nicaragua (3 MT), the United Arab Emirates (1 MT), and the Leeward Windward Islands (1 MT) for week ending January 23. These exports have been reported in error.

The subsequent week’s seemingly high-low value buying and selling ranges:

April lean hog futures–$88.00 to $95.00 and with a sideways-higher bias

March soybean meal futures–$300.00 to $321.60, and with a sideways-higher bias

March corn futures–$4.80 to $5.10 and a sideways-higher bias
